Tuna Melt Recipe Ingredients

For the Tuna Mixture
Tuna2 x 5oz cans, drained; the main protein source for a heartwarming classic.
Onion1 medium, chopped; adds a delightful crunch and flavor.
Celery1/2 stalk, chopped; gives a fresh taste; bell pepper is a great substitute.
Garlic1 clove, minced; elevates flavor; garlic powder works too if you’re in a pinch.
Parsley1 tablespoon, chopped; adds freshness; dill can be a lovely alternative or simply omit.

For the Creamy Base
Mayonnaise3-4 tablespoons; binds everything together while adding creaminess; Greek yogurt is a lighter option.
Extra Virgin Olive Oil3 tablespoons, divided; enriches the mix and is perfect for sautéing; can be omitted for a lighter dish.
Mozzarella1/3 cup, shredded; delivers that gooey, melty goodness; feel free to swap for cheddar or pepper jack.

For the Sandwich
BreadSliced; serve as the comforting base; any preferred type works, but sourdough adds a delightful twist.
ButterSoftened; intensifies flavor and promotes browning; skip for a dairy-free version.
Salt and PepperTo taste; essential for seasoning; don’t forget to adjust according to your preference.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Tuna Melt Recipe

Step 1: Prepare the Tuna Mixture
Begin by draining the two cans of tuna and transferring the contents to a mixing bowl. Next, chop the onion, celery, and parsley, and mince the garlic. Add all these ingredients to the bowl with the tuna. Mix well until evenly combined, ensuring the flavors meld beautifully together. This tuna mixture is the heart of your scrumptious Tuna Melt.

Step 2: Add Creamy Ingredients
Into the same bowl, stir in 3-4 tablespoons of mayonnaise and 3 tablespoons of extra virgin olive oil. Mix in the 1/3 cup of shredded mozzarella cheese, which will add that delicious gooey texture to your Tuna Melt. Season your mixture with salt and pepper to taste, ensuring it’s flavorful and ready to rock.

Step 3: Heat the Skillet
Place a non-stick skillet over medium heat and add 1 tablespoon of olive oil. Allow the oil to heat up for about one minute; you’ll know it’s ready when it shimmers. This step is crucial for achieving that perfect golden-brown exterior on your Tuna Melt.

Step 4: Assemble the Sandwich
While the skillet heats, take a slice of bread and butter one side generously. Once the skillet is hot, place the buttered side down into it. Spoon about 2 tablespoons of the prepared tuna mixture onto the bread, spreading it evenly. Make sure to keep it centered so it doesn’t spill out when you grill it.

Step 5: Top the Tuna Mixture
Butter another slice of bread on one side. Once your first slice with the tuna mixture has heated for about 2-3 minutes and is golden brown, carefully place the second slice, butter-side up, on top of the mixture. This will create a delightful sandwich ready for grilling!

Step 6: Grill Until Toasted
Cook the sandwich for an additional 2-3 minutes or until the bottom slice is a beautiful golden brown. Carefully flip the sandwich using a spatula; you want the top to be browned and slightly crispy. Cook the other side for another 2-3 minutes, keeping an eye out to avoid burning.

Step 7: Serve and Enjoy
Once both sides of your Tuna Melt are perfectly toasted and golden, remove it from the skillet. Let it rest for a minute before slicing it in half. This Tuna Melt Recipe is best served warm, allowing the cheese to remain gooey—the perfect comfort food for busy weeknights or quick lunches!

Storage Tips for Tuna Melt Recipe

Fridge: Store leftover assembled Tuna Melt in an airtight container for up to 1 day. When you’re ready to enjoy it again, reheat gently in a skillet to keep the bread crispy.

Freezer: For the tuna mixture, it can be stored in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months. Thaw overnight in the fridge before using. Avoid freezing the assembled sandwich to maintain texture.

Reheating: To reheat, place the sandwich in a preheated skillet over medium heat for about 3-5 minutes per side. This keeps the bread crispy and the filling hot and gooey.

Make-Ahead: If you want to prep ahead, mix the tuna salad a day in advance and store it in the fridge. This way, you can quickly whip up your delicious Tuna Melt any time!

Expert Tips for the Best Tuna Melt

Quality Tuna Matters: Always opt for higher-quality tuna brands like Wild Planet Albacore. The flavor difference is remarkable, enhancing your Tuna Melt recipe!

Don’t Overstuff: Avoid piling too much filling onto the bread. A well-balanced ratio of tuna and cheese creates a perfect melt and prevents spilling.

Perfect Toasting: For a golden crust, use a combination of butter and olive oil on the bread. This both enriches the flavor and helps achieve an even brown color.

Try Unique Cheeses: Consider experimenting with different cheeses like cheddar or pepper jack for a twist in flavor. Each type elevates the Tuna Melt in its own delightful way.

Meal Prep Tip: Prepare the tuna mixture in advance and refrigerate it for up to 2 days. This makes for a quick assembly on busy nights.

Slicing Technique: When slicing your finished sandwich, use a serrated knife. It helps maintain the crispy exterior while giving you clean, delectable halves.

How do I choose the perfect tuna for my Tuna Melt?
Absolutely! When selecting tuna, look for high-quality brands like Wild Planet Albacore. These tend to have a richer flavor and better texture than less expensive options. Also, consider the type of can—water-packed tuna often maintains the fish’s flavor better than oil-packed varieties, which can make the sandwich greasier.

What’s the best way to store leftover Tuna Melt?
Store any leftover assembled Tuna Melt in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 1 day. When it’s time to enjoy it again, reheat gently in a skillet to keep the bread crisp. If you have extra tuna mixture, store it in the fridge for up to 2 days for a quick assembly later.

Can I freeze the tuna mixture for later use?
Yes, you can! The tuna mixture can be stored in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months. To use, simply thaw it in the fridge overnight. I recommend avoiding freezing the assembled sandwich itself, as it can compromise the deliciously crispy texture.

What should I do if my Tuna Melt turns out too mushy?
Very! If your Tuna Melt ends up mushy, consider reducing the amount of mayonnaise or adding more solid ingredients like celery or onions to provide balance. To avoid this in the future, make sure to properly drain your tuna and mix it thoroughly with other ingredients, avoiding excessive moisture.

Is this Tuna Melt Recipe suitable for those with dietary restrictions?
This Tuna Melt can easily be adapted! For a dairy-free version, simply omit or replace the cheese with a dairy-free alternative. You could also substitute Greek yogurt for mayonnaise to make it lighter. Just take care if you have any allergies to tuna or specific vegetables—feel free to customize to suit your needs!

How can I make my Tuna Melt even more flavorful?
To enhance the flavor of your Tuna Melt, consider incorporating some spices or herbs into the mixture. A dash of lemon juice or a sprinkle of smoked paprika can elevate the taste dramatically. Don’t be afraid to get creative by adding things like jalapeños for heat or capers for a briny kick!

Tuna Melt Recipe

Delicious Tuna Melt Recipe in Just 15 Minutes

This Tuna Melt Recipe is a quick and satisfying meal that can be prepared in just 15 minutes. Perfect for busy nights!
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 5 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Servings: 2 sandwiches
Course: Lunch
Cuisine: American
Calories: 400

Ingredients
  

For the Tuna Mixture
  • 10 oz Tuna drained; the main protein source for a heartwarming classic.
  • 1 medium Onion chopped; adds a delightful crunch and flavor.
  • 0.5 stalk Celery chopped; gives a fresh taste; bell pepper is a great substitute.
  • 1 clove Garlic minced; elevates flavor; garlic powder works too if you’re in a pinch.
  • 1 tablespoon Parsley chopped; adds freshness; dill can be a lovely alternative or simply omit.
For the Creamy Base
  • 3-4 tablespoons Mayonnaise binds everything together while adding creaminess; Greek yogurt is a lighter option.
  • 3 tablespoons Extra Virgin Olive Oil divided; enriches the mix and is perfect for sautéing; can be omitted for a lighter dish.
  • 1/3 cup Mozzarella shredded; delivers that gooey, melty goodness; feel free to swap for cheddar or pepper jack.
For the Sandwich
  • Bread Sliced; any preferred type works, but sourdough adds a delightful twist.
  • Butter Softened; intensifies flavor and promotes browning; skip for a dairy-free version.
  • Salt and Pepper To taste; essential for seasoning.

Equipment

  • Non-stick skillet
  • Mixing Bowl
  • spatula

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for Tuna Melt Recipe
  1. Begin by draining the two cans of tuna and transferring the contents to a mixing bowl. Next, chop the onion, celery, and parsley, and mince the garlic. Add all these ingredients to the bowl with the tuna. Mix well until evenly combined.
  2. Stir in 3-4 tablespoons of mayonnaise and 3 tablespoons of extra virgin olive oil. Mix in the 1/3 cup of shredded mozzarella cheese. Season your mixture with salt and pepper to taste.
  3. Place a non-stick skillet over medium heat and add 1 tablespoon of olive oil. Allow the oil to heat up for about one minute.
  4. Take a slice of bread and butter one side generously. Place the buttered side down into the skillet. Spoon about 2 tablespoons of the prepared tuna mixture onto the bread.
  5. Butter another slice of bread on one side. Once your first slice with the tuna mixture has heated for about 2-3 minutes and is golden brown, place the second slice, butter-side up, on top of the mixture.
  6. Cook the sandwich for an additional 2-3 minutes or until the bottom slice is golden brown. Carefully flip the sandwich using a spatula; cook the other side for another 2-3 minutes.
  7. Once both sides of your Tuna Melt are perfectly toasted, remove it from the skillet. Let it rest for a minute before slicing it in half.
